The launch of a major video game is often defined by two things: beautiful graphics and, sometimes, disastrous bugs. When a game ships with flaws, millions of users voice their frustration instantly. But why should a business owner care about the "rigorous testing of a video game?"
The answer is simple: The highly organized, user-centric methodologies of game testing—known as Playtesting—are exactly what's required to guarantee your business software (whether it's an internal CRM or a high-traffic customer portal) is reliable, secure, and enjoyable to use.
The True Cost of Bugs: The Business Equivalent of a "Game Crash"
In the gaming world, a bug can mean a character falls through the floor or the game crashes. In the business world, the stakes are much higher:
-
Lost Revenue: A bug in an e-commerce checkout process directly results in cart abandonment and lost sales.
-
Reputational Damage: Flaws in a customer-facing app breed frustration and negative public reviews.
-
Operational Stalling: A failure in internal management software brings core business processes to a halt.
At ZA TechLabs, our Software Testing & QA team operates with the same rigor as an AAA game studio, ensuring your application is not just functional, but battle-tested against failure.
1. Functional Testing: Do All the Systems Work Together?
In a game, functional testing verifies that every sword swing registers damage, every save point works, and the level loads correctly. In business software, it verifies the fundamental transactions:
-
Registration: Does the user successfully sign up and receive a confirmation email?
-
Payment: Does the money flow correctly from the customer's account to yours?
-
Data Integrity: When an employee updates a record, is that change reflected instantly across the entire system?
We test every single feature and interaction path to confirm that your custom software operates exactly as designed, ensuring a seamless flow from input to output.
2. Performance and Load Testing: Preventing Server Meltdown
A gaming launch day can see millions of simultaneous logins—a massive load. If the servers fail, the game is unplayable. Similarly, your business software must survive peak demand:
-
Load Testing: We simulate thousands of users interacting with your system simultaneously (e.g., during a Black Friday sale or a major report generation).
-
Stress Testing: We push the system beyond its limits to find the point of failure, allowing us to implement fixes that guarantee stability and fast response times, even under unexpected pressure.
This process, which is essential in Cloud Solutions & Infrastructure, guarantees that high traffic translates into revenue, not server crashes.
3. Usability (UX) Testing: Making Software Enjoyable
A game that is too difficult to control or has a confusing menu interface will fail. The same applies to your business application. Usability Testing ensures that the software is intuitive and requires minimal training.
We use UX testing methodologies that mimic playtesting: watching real users interact with the system to identify points of frustration, confusion, or inefficiency.
-
The Goal: To reduce the time it takes an employee to complete a task (improving internal efficiency) or the time it takes a customer to purchase a product (boosting conversion rates). We focus on making the experience so smooth, the user doesn't even have to think about the interface.
By adopting the intense, user-first perspective of gaming QA, ZA TechLabs ensures your business software is robust, reliable, and perfectly suited to deliver on its promise.
Login to comment
To post a comment, you must be logged in. Please login. Login
Comments (0)